OBSCU'RITY, n. L. obscuritas.

1. Darkness want of light.

We wait for light, but behold obscurity. Isaiah 59 .

2. A state of retirement from the world a state of being unnoticed privacy.

You are not for obscurity designed.

3. Darkness of meaning unintelligibleness as the obscurity of writings or of a particular passage.
4. Illegibleness as the obscurity of letters or of an inscription.
5. A state of being unknown to fame humble condition as the obscurity of birth or parentage.
